Terror funding case: NIA raids in Lohardaga, recovers illegal weapons and documents

Ranchi, April 9: A team of NIA and a local police station raided the brick kiln located in Opa village of the Kudu police station area of Lohardaga district on Sunday in connection with the terror funding case.

One pistol, six bullets and many important documents of land and bank were recovered during the raid. The brick kiln owner has fled from the spot. The NIA and the police are raiding possible places for his arrest.

It is being told that the NIA had received secret information that Rs 15 lakh-reward Maoist Regional Commander Ravindra Ganjhu is being invested in different businesses by the brick kiln owner. After this the NIA team reached and raided with the help of the local police. Although neither the Maoist commander was found on the spot nor the businessman but many important documents and weapons related to the Maoist commander have been recovered.
